Rick (Andrew Lincoln) and his group managed to team up with the rest of the Alexandrians to successfully try and lure the walkers to a spot 20 miles away, but at the last minute, a car horn was honked incessantly from within Alexandria's walls-drawing the herd of thousands back towards the community.

Now, in a preview clip for the October 18 episode, the danger that the herd poses to the community becomes much more real, as walkers begin to penetrate the community's weak walls.

"I saw them from upstairs, they're coming in from all over," Carl (Chandler Riggs) says to Carol (Melissa McBride) in the clip.

"You need to stay here and keep Judith safe," she warns as she runs out the door of the house.

Sure enough, things do become dangerous and everyone is on high alert as they try to prevent a mass attack-with Maggie (Lauren Cohan) and others on the move and shooting their guns in an effort to keep things under control, and others becoming critically injured in the process.

However, the biggest threat appears to come to Jesse (Alexandra Breckenridge) and her family, as they take refuge in a closet during what seems like an invasion on their home in particular.
